Claims (7)
1. Vorrichtung zur Dosierung von Flüssigkeiten, insbeson
dere Reagenzien, wie bei der Zuckerbestimmung in Flüs
sigkeiten, gekennzeichnet durch einen Vorratsbehälter
(1.4) mit einem Saugrohr (1.4.3), das von nahezu dem
Boden (1.4.5) des Behälters mindestens zu dessen Ober
seite (1.4.2) reicht, und mit einer Spritze (1.3) die
einen Zylinder (1.3.1) und einen in diesem bewegbaren
Kolben (1.3.2) aufweist, wobei ein Öffnungsansatz
(1.3.3) des Zylinders (1.3.1) dichtend in den oberen
Bereichen (1.4.6) des Saugrohres (1.4.3) einsetzbar ist
und derart mittels des Kolbens (1.3.2) eine bestimmte
Flüssigkeitsmenge aus dem Vorratsbehälter (1.4) in den
Zylinder (1.3.1) der Spritze (1.3) aufsaugbar ist.
2. Vorrichtung nach Anspruch 1, dadurch gekennzeichnet,
dass das Saugrohr aus der Oberseite (1.4.2) des Vor
ratsbehälters (1.4) herausragt.
3. Vorrichtung nach Anspruch 1 oder 2, dadurch gekenn
zeichnet, dass der Behälter eine lösbare Abdeckung,
insbesondere in Form eines Schraubenverschlusses auf
weist.
4. Vorrichtung nach einem der vorangehenden Ansprüche, da
durch gekennzeichnet, dass der Behälter aus elastischen
Material besteht.
5. Vorrichtung nach einem der vorangehenden Ansprüche, da
durch gekennzeichnet, dass Spritze und/Behälter aus
Kunststoff bestehen.
6. Vorrichtung nach Anspruch 5, dadurch gekennzeichnet,
dass die Spritze aus Hartkunststoff besteht.
7. Vorrichtung zur Zuckerbestimmung in Flüssigkeiten, ge
kennzeichnet durch mindestens eine Vorrichtung nach ei
nem der vorangehenden Ansprüche 1 bis 6 als Dosiervor
richtung und einer elektrischen Widerstandsheizplatte
(2.1) als Wärmequelle für die Umsetzung des Reaktions
gemisches.
